Ingredients

  • 1 pound rotini pasta, cooked and drained (reserve 1 cup of cooking water)
  • 3 cups cooked chicken, diced or shredded
  • 2 (15 ounce) jars Alfredo sauce
  • 1 cup garlic parmesan sauce
  • 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
  • 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ish, opt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at the Oven:
    • Start by pre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C). This ensures that your oven is at the right temperature when the pasta bake is ready to go in.
  2. Prepare the Baking Dish:
    • Lightly grease a 9×13 inch baking dish with cooking spray or butter. This step prevents the pasta from sticking to the dish during baking, making it easier to serve and clean up.
  3. Cook the Pasta:
    • Cook the rotini pasta according to the package instructions until al dente. This typically takes about 8-10 minutes. Drain the pasta and reserve 1 cup of the cooking water for later use.
  4. Combine Ingredients:
    • In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ked pasta, diced or shredded chicken, Alfredo sauce, garlic parmesan sauce, half of the shredded mozzarella cheese, and half of the grated Parmesan cheese. Season the mixture with ½ teaspoon of salt and ¼ teaspoon of black pepper.
    • If the mixture appears too thick, add about ½ cup of the reserved pasta cooking water to make it creamier.
  5. Transfer to Baking Dish:
    • Pour the creamy pasta and chicken mixture into the prepared baking dish, spreading it out evenly.
  6. Add the Cheese Topping:
    • Sprinkle the remaining mozzarella and Parmesan cheese over the top of the pasta. This layer of cheese will melt and create a deliciously golden crust on the finished dish.
  7. Bake:
    •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il to prevent the cheese from burning.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
  8. Optional Broiling:
    • If you prefer a golden brown top, remove the foil and broil the pasta bake for an additional 2-3 minutes. Keep a close eye on it to avoid burning.
  9. Cool and Serve:
    • Once baked, remove the pasta bake from the oven and let it cool for about 5 minutes. This allows the dish to set, making it easier to slice and serve.
  10. Garnish:
    • Garnish with freshly chopped parsley if desired. This adds a pop of color and freshness to the dish.
  11. Enjoy:
    • Serve the Garlic Parmesan Chicken Pasta Bake warm and enjoy the creamy, cheesy goodness with your family and friends.

Variations of the Recipe

  • Vegetarian Option: Substitute the chicken with sautéed mushrooms, spinach, or a blend of your favorite vegetables for a vegetarian version of this dish.
  • Spicy Kick: Add crushed red pepper flakes or diced jalapeños to the pasta mixture for a spicy twist.
  • Different Proteins: Replace the chicken with turkey bacon, chicken ham, or even ground beef for a different flavor profile.
  • Whole Wheat Pasta: For a healthier option, use whole wheat rotini pasta instead of regular pasta.
  • Extra Garlic: If you’re a garlic lover, consider adding minced garlic to the sauce mixture for an extra punch of flavor.

FAQs

Can I make this dish 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the Garlic Parmesan Chicken Pasta Bake up to a day in advance. Assemble the dish as instructed, cover it tightly with plastic wrap or aluminum foil, and refrigerate. When you’re ready to bake, let it sit at room temperature for about 20 minutes before placing it in the preheated oven.

How do I store leftovers?

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, place the pasta bake in a microwave-safe dish and heat in the microwave or oven until warmed through.

Can I freeze the Garlic Parmesan Chicken Pasta Bake?

Yes, this dish freezes well. After baking, let the pasta bake cool completely. Then,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il, and freeze for up to 3 months. To reheat, thaw overnight in the refrigerator and bake at 350°F (175°C) until heated through.

What other types of pasta can I use?

While rotini is great for holding the sauce, you can use other pasta shapes like penne, fusilli, or even macaroni. Choose a shape that will capture the sauce well.

Can I use homemade Alfredo sauce?

Absolutely! If you prefer making your own Alfredo sauce, you can use it in place of the jarred version. This will add a personal touch to the dish and allow you to control the ingredients.
